Weka
Weka is a collection of machine learning algorithms for solving real-world data mining problems. It is written in Java and runs on almost any platform. The algorithms can either be applied directly to a dataset or called from your own Java code.

Open PowerShell or Command Prompt and run: winget install UniversityOfWaikato.Weka. Winget is built into Windows 10 (1809+) and Windows 11.

Weka is available under the GNU General Public License version 3.0 license. Use winget or the direct download link on this page.
Run winget upgrade UniversityOfWaikato.Weka in PowerShell or Windows Terminal to update Weka to the latest version.
Run winget uninstall UniversityOfWaikato.Weka in an elevated PowerShell window, or go to Settings > Apps > Installed Apps.
